Easter Sunday Celebrations in Ranchi: Faith, Family, and Festive Joy
Ranchi: Early morning prayers by a large gathering of the faithful in churches marked the beginning of Easter Sunday, reflecting a day filled with faith, celebration and togetherness.
“Easter is the foundation of Christian faith, symbolising hope, renewal and victory of life over death. It is also a time when families come together in love and gratitude,” said Father David Fernandes, a priest at St Mary’s Cathedral.
As the morning prayers concluded, the celebrations shifted to homes and neighbourhoods. Families hosted gatherings, shared festive meals and exchanged sweets, turning the day into a social occasion. Children added to the cheer with games, Easter egg hunts and laughter.
“Easter marks the Resurrection of Jesus Christ, reminding us that hope always rises even after the darkest moments. It teaches faith, forgiveness and new beginnings. Celebrating it with family makes it more meaningful, as we not only rejoice in the miracle but also strengthen bonds of love and togetherness,” said Anita Ekka, a Morabadi resident.
Restaurants and cafes across the city embraced the festive mood, offering special Easter menus, themed desserts and discounts, drawing crowds of youngsters and families. “We wanted to create a space where people could celebrate beyond homes,” said Rahul Mehta, a cafe owner at Purulia Road.
Blending prayers with celebrations, Easter Sunday brought out a colourful mix of faith, family bonding and community joy.
